About Heirloom (2021) — A Heartwarming Documentary of Family Tradition

In 'Heirloom (2021)', director Evan Rivard explores a centuries-old tradition where a family heirloom is passed down through generations. This documentary delves into the significance of a ring that's been a symbol of unity and family bonds. Bridgette Wilson and Scott Kerill star in this heartwarming yet thought-provoking film that uncovers the history and the emotional impact of the heirloom on the next generation of family members.

As the next heir recounts the story of the ring, the documentary masterfully weaves a narrative that highlights the complexities of family relationships and the true meaning of heritage. 'Heirloom (2021)' is a poignant exploration of what it means to be part of a family and the lasting legacy that we leave behind.
